HF3135
Douglas County; Interstate Highway 94 and County State-Aid Highway 17 interchange funding provided, bonds issued, and money appropriated.
Legislative Session 94 (2025-2026)
Related bill: SF3284
AI Generated Summary
Purpose of the Bill
The purpose of this bill is to allocate funds for infrastructure improvements in Douglas County, Minnesota. Specifically, the bill aims to support the initial planning stages for an interchange at the intersection of Interstate 94 and County State-Aid Highway 17.
Main Provisions
- Appropriation of Funds: The bill designates $1,500,000 from the bond proceeds account within the state transportation fund. These funds are intended to be used by the commissioner of transportation to provide a grant to Douglas County.
- Use of Funds: The allocated money is for conducting preliminary engineering and final design work for the interchange project.
- Bond Sale Authorization: The bill authorizes the sale and issuance of state bonds up to the amount of $1,500,000. This is to finance the grant that will be awarded to Douglas County.
Significant Changes to Existing Law
This bill provides new appropriations and authorizations specific to the construction of an interchange in Douglas County, affecting state transportation funding and bonding processes as outlined in existing Minnesota Statutes.
